Six Children Abducted from Playground in Teknaf

In a shocking incident in Teknaf, six children were abducted by armed assailants while playing in Baharchhara, a remote area of Cox’s Bazar district. Although two of the children managed to escape, four remain in the hands of the kidnappers.

The abduction occurred on Sunday evening at approximately 6:00 pm in South Shilkhali East Para of Baharchhara Union. The incident was confirmed by Hafiz Ahmad, a local councillor representing Ward 4 of the union. According to him, the assailants emerged from the nearby hills, brandishing weapons, and forcibly took the six children, whose ages range from 13 to 17 years, into the forested hills.

Councillor Ahmad stated, “Local residents immediately informed the police. Both the community and the authorities are now conducting search operations in the surrounding hills to locate the abducted children. As of 9:30 pm, we have not been able to find the four remaining children. Preliminary indications suggest that the kidnappers’ motive is likely ransom.”

Inspector Durjoy Biswas, in charge of the Baharchhara Police Investigation Centre, told reporters, “The police visited the scene after receiving reports of the abduction. However, as of 9:30 pm, no formal complaint had yet been lodged by the families. We are actively working to recover the children safely.”

According to both district police records and local sources, Teknaf has seen a worrying rise in abductions in recent years. Over the past 21 months, a total of 272 people, including minors and young adults, have been abducted from various areas of the upazila. Most victims have been released following payment of ransom.

Experts and local officials have expressed concern that such incidents instil fear and insecurity in the community, particularly in the remote and hilly areas of Teknaf. The abduction of children, they say, highlights vulnerabilities in community safety measures and raises urgent questions about law enforcement capacity and preventive measures in the region.

Local authorities are urging parents and residents to remain vigilant, particularly in hilly and isolated areas, and to report any suspicious activity immediately. They emphasise that close cooperation between the community and the police is essential to prevent further abductions.

The incident not only underscores the dangers faced by children in vulnerable regions but also reflects a broader societal challenge. Kidnapping for ransom, according to experts, is increasingly used by criminal elements as a lucrative strategy, and the psychological impact on victims and their families can be severe.

With search operations ongoing, authorities have reiterated that they are employing all available resources to recover the children safely and to ensure that such criminal acts are prevented in the future.
